Experience in complex structural aircraft modifications. Ability to work Friday -Sunday 0600-1630 and occasional overtime.
Education and Experience Requirements
High School Diploma or GED required. 8 years aviation maintenance experience (avionics, electrical, and/or mechanical) to include 2 years of relevant Gulfstream aircraft experience and 2 years of aircraft inspection experience. A&P (FAA Airframe and Powerplant) license required.
Position Purpose:
Performs inspections of aircraft, aircraft components, and reviews paperwork to ensure that workmanship meets acceptable standards of quality, and that aircraft are returned to service in an airworthy condition with all required. documentation properly completed and filed. Works as an integral part of the Quality Control/Assurance team assuring aircraft/components are in compliance to FAA/CAA requirements.
Job Description
Principle Duties and Responsibilities:
Essential Functions:
Responsible for Quality Control inspections on aircraft/components .
Completes inspections of aircraft, engine, and component repairs and alterations to ensure conformity to FAA approved/acceptable data .
Coordinates mechanical, electrical and inspection requirements on the aircraft during maintenance or outfitting .
Keeps accurate, neat and legible records of the work performed on aircraft/components .
Coordinates throughout assigned jobs with RTS to ensure accurate aircraft records are produced in a timely manner .
Conducts audits of maintenance documentation for accuracy and completion on all aircraft prior to approval for return to service .
Ensures aircraft/components are airworthy prior to any flight activities .
Mentors technicians on effective documentation .
Additional Functions:
Communicates with management as required. to identify work assignments and delivery schedules .
Provides technical support to inspection personnel in supporting the FAA and/or CAA documented requirements .
Perform other duties as assigned.
Other Requirements:
Strong computer skills.
Knowledge of inspection and maintenance procedures for various aircraft models and systems.
Knowledge of pertinent technical reference materials.
Proficient in blueprint reading and interpretation, shop mathematics and QC Procedures.
Working knowledge and application of Quality Assurance and/or Quality Control systems and methodologies.
Must be able to read, write, speak, and understand the English language.
